PBS Professor Alice Cronin-Golomb to receive Mentorship Award from the American Psychological Association

Professor Alice Cronin-Golomb will receive the 2016 Mentorship Award in Aging from the APA during the annual convention in Denver this August. The award recognizes Prof. Cronin-Golomb’s record of consistent support, guidance, and strong direction to undergraduate and graduate students in aging and adult development. PBS congratulates Dr. Cronin-Golomb on this well-deserved award.
